The coin ship... Does this thing appear randomly or is there something I can do to trigger it? Thanks.
You should try google first for questions like these... this is what I found within 5 seconds: Treasure Ship In Worlds 1, 3, 5, and 6, you can turn a Wandering Hammer Brother on the map screen into a lucrative Treasure Ship. Here's what you have to do: 1.Have at least one Wandering Hammer Brother left on the map screen. 2. At the end of a level, hit the Roulette Block like normal. After the timer counts down giving you the time bonus, if your Coin total is a multiple of 11 (i.e. 11, 22, 33, etc., but NOT zero), and if the tens digit (the second number from the right) of your score matches the repeated number in your Coins total, you'll get the Treasure Ship to appear on the map screen. Example: 55 coins, score of 27650. Of course, you get 50 points per second remaining after you hit the Roulette Block, which affects the all-important tens digit of your score, so you'll have do a little planning ahead. Just keep in mind that if you stop the timer on an even number, your tens digit won't change. If you stop the timer on an odd number, your tens digit will increase by 5. So, if you're at the Roulette Block with 66 Coins and a score ending in -60, you'll want to stop on an even number. If you have 88 Coins and a score ending in -30, you'll want to stop the timer on an odd number. The Treasure Ship contains 169 Coins and a hidden 1-Up Mushroom just before the end pipe.

It takes a minimum amount of speed to get into the wall. The physics are a bit different in SMB3 making it take more momentum to accomplish it.

The minimum speed to get a wall jump to work is 33, because of that we weren't able to wall jump immediately after entering the first door in Bowser's castle.
